Rosa Luna Fields is a small alpaca farm situated in Pekin. The main attraction is the Huacaya Alpacas. Alpacas are native to the Andes mountains, at altitudes of up to 13,000 ft above sea level. Its natural range encompasses four South American countries.

Rosa Luna Fields presently have 8 females and a four month old male named Leo. Alpacas are fascinating animals each with their own personality. The other girls on the farm are Italian Honeybees and our chickens and guineas.

Rosa Luna Fields shear once a year, usually in April. They collect the fiber for yarn and crafts and the girls stay cool in our hot, humid summers. Their handmade products will be 30% warmer than sheep wool and you will feel like you are in heaven! The softness is amazing! Alpaca fiber does not have any lanolin, making it hypoallergenic and a perfect choice for anyone with allergies to sheep wool. Other benefits include odor resistance and it's naturally water resistant.
